shepherd 是什么意思 |
音标:[ 'ʃepəd ] | 过去式:shepherded 过去分词:shepherded 名词复数:shepherds 现在分词:shepherding |
|
中文翻译与英英解释 | n. 1.牧羊人;牧羊者。 2.牧羊狗[犬] (=shepherd dog)。 3.牧师。 4.保护者;指导者。 短语和例子 S- Kings 古埃及希克索[“牧人”]王朝的国王。 the (good) S- 基督。 vt. 1.牧(羊);放牧。 2.照看。 3.领导,指导。

| a herder of sheep (on an open range); someone who keeps the sheep together in a flock 同义词:sheepherder, sheepman,
| | a clergyman who watches over a group of people
|
| tend as a shepherd, as of sheep or goats
| | watch over like a shepherd, as a teacher of her pupils
|
A shepherd (), or sheepherder, is a person who tends, feeds, or guards flocks of sheep. The word stems from an amalgam of sheep herder. |
